Control prices of 16 essential items were announced by the Minister of Industry and Commerce Rishad Bathiudeen today morning. The Gazette is expected tomorrow 15 July-prices are effective immediately.
The Items are:
1. Chicken meat with Skin Rs 410 per Kilo - without Skin Rs 495 per Kilo
2. Red Dhall Rs 169 per Kilo
3. Spratts (Thai) Rs 495 per Kilo - Spratts (Dubai) Rs 410 per Kilo
4. Gram-Chickpeas Rs 260 per Kilo
5. Green moong/Green Grams Rs 220 per Kilo
6. Canned Fish Regular 480 grams Rs 140 (105 Grams– Rs 70)
7. White Sugar Rs 95 per kilo
8. White Flour Rs 87 per kilo
9. Full cream milk powder - imported Rs 810 per Kilo – Domestic Rs 735 per Kilo
10. Potatoes – Local – No control price Potatoes – imported – Rs 120 per kilo
11. B Onions imported – Rs 78 per Kilo
12. Dried chillies – Rs 385 per Kilo
13. Dried Fish – Katta – Rs 1100 per Kilo
14. Dried Fish – Salaya– Rs 425 per Kilo
15. Maldive fish –Rs 1500 per kilo
16. Sustagen – Rs 1500
